在数字化浪潮席卷全球的今天,数据已成为驱动企业决策的核心引擎。当电商平台需要实时分析用户购物行为投放精准广告,当金融机构要在毫秒间完成交易与风险检测,传统的数据库架构已难以满足这种既要处理海量事务又要实时分析的复杂需求。这背后,正是AP(分析处理)数据库架构与高效数据管理技术支撑着现代企业的智慧大脑。

一、AP数据库架构的核心设计

AP数据库架构优化与高效数据管理关键技术研究

区别于传统的行式存储,现代AP数据库采用列式存储架构将数据按列组织。这种设计如同图书馆将同类型书籍集中存放,当需要统计某类图书借阅量时,只需扫描特定书架。例如在销售分析场景中,系统无需读取整条订单记录,仅需提取"销售额"和"日期"两列即可完成月度统计,使查询速度提升5-10倍。

分布式架构的引入让AP数据库突破单机性能瓶颈。通过数据分片技术,十亿级订单数据可分散存储在数百个节点,类似大型超市将商品分区域管理。这种架构不仅支持横向扩展,还能通过多副本机制确保数据安全,即使部分服务器故障,系统仍能持续提供服务。

二、AP数据库的五大关键技术

1. 行列混合存储引擎

HTAP(混合事务分析处理)系统采用"主行存+内存列存"的复合结构,犹如同时配备速记本和计算器的双装备。行存保证交易记录的高效写入,内存列存则通过即时同步机制,使分析查询能获取最新数据。Oracle Heatwave等系统正是通过这种设计,在金融交易场景实现毫秒级反欺诈分析。

2. 向量化查询引擎

传统查询像手工逐条核对账目,向量化技术则将数据打包处理。如同集装箱运输大幅提升港口吞吐量,该技术使CPU能批量处理数据列,将分析效率提升3倍以上。最新技术还能智能识别GPU加速场景,在图像识别类查询中实现百倍性能飞跃。

3. 智能资源调度系统

AP数据库配备双重调度策略:当实时分析需求激增时,系统自动调配80%资源保障查询响应;在凌晨业务低谷期,60%资源会转向数据压缩等后台任务。这种动态调度机制如同智能电网,确保资源利用率始终保持在90%以上。

4. 多级缓存体系

从内存热点缓存到SSD温数据存储,系统构建了三级缓存结构。热数据(如当日交易)常驻内存,温数据(近三月记录)使用压缩列存,冷数据(历史存档)采用低成本存储。这种分级管理使存储成本降低70%,同时保证高频查询亚秒级响应。

5. 增量数据同步

采用LSM-Tree结构的存储引擎,将新增数据暂存于内存缓冲区,定期合并到主存储区。这种机制如同快递分拣中心,实时接收包裹(数据写入)的每小时批量装车发运(数据持久化),既保证实时性又避免频繁IO操作。

三、高效数据管理的四维优化策略

1. 数据分区智能管理

将活跃数据(近三月)与历史数据分离存储,类似医院将急诊室与住院部分区管理。通过自动归档机制,系统查询性能提升40%,存储成本降低65%。某银行采用该方案后,信用卡交易分析效率从小时级缩短至分钟级。

2. 复合索引优化技术

针对"时间-地区-品类"多维查询,系统自动生成组合索引。这种优化如同给图书馆目录增加联合检索标签,使复杂查询速度提升8倍。智能索引推荐算法还能根据查询模式动态调整索引结构。

3. 物化视图预计算

通过预先生成周销售汇总表等物化视图,系统将复杂查询转化为简单查表操作。某电商平台应用该技术后,大促期间的实时看板加载时间从15秒缩短至0.5秒。

4. 资源隔离保障机制

采用容器化技术将分析负载与事务处理隔离,如同高速公路设置客货分离车道。通过cgroup限制资源抢占,确保核心交易系统不受分析任务影响,事务成功率维持在99.99%。

四、面向未来的技术演进

随着边缘计算兴起,新型AP数据库开始支持分层计算架构。在智慧物流场景中,车载终端进行本地实时路径分析,区域中心处理车辆调度,总部完成全局决策,形成"边缘-区域-中心"三级智能体系。AI驱动的自优化系统正在崭露头角,某实验系统通过机器学习,自动将查询耗时降低42%,错误配置减少75%。

在这些技术创新推动下,AP数据库正在突破PB级数据处理瓶颈。某国家级征信平台采用分布式列存架构,每日处理20亿条信用记录,复杂查询响应时间控制在3秒内,为数字经济时代提供了坚实的数据基座。技术的持续进化,正在将实时智能决策的能力赋予每个现代组织。